The 3.0 TID V6-engine: Naturally
this high-performance diesel has all the advanced technology that you would
expect, such as four common-rail fuel injection, overhead camshafts, 24 valves,
variable turbo and more. The overall effect is seamless on-demand performance,
a recurring hallmark of Saab turbo engines. 350 Nm of torque is available
from 1800 r/min, resulting in superb acceleration for rapid overtaking. In
fact, it will thrust you from 60 to 100 km/h in just 7.5 seconds and it offers
a top speed of 215 km/h.
The 2.2 TiD engine: This engine pro vides power enough for quick overtaking combined with low fuel consumption, making it ideal for driving long distances. In the outside lane, it will sweep you from 60 to 100 km/h in 8.4 seconds. Fuel consumption in highway driving is 5.2 litres/100 km.

Saab 9-5 Sedan/Wagon 2.2 TiD, engine specification
- Engine type: Four-cylinder turbodiesel.
- Displacement: 2.171 dm3.
- EEC rating: 88 kW (120 bhp) at 4000 r/min.
- EEC peak torque: 280 Nm at 1500—3000 r/min.
- Transmission: Manual 5-speed or optional Automatic 5-speed.
- Top speed, manual: 200 km/h (Wagon 195 km/h).
- Acceleration to 100 km/h, manual: 11.0 sec (Wagon 11.9 sec).
- Overtaking acceleration, manual: 60—100 km/h in fourth gear 8.4 sec (Wagon 9.1 sec).
- Fuel consumption, manual 1/100 km*: 9.0/5.2/6.6 (Wagon 9.3/5.4/6.9).
- C02 emission, manual g/km*: 238/139/175 (Wagon 240/145/178).
Saab 9-5 Sedan/Wagon 3.0 TiD, engine specification
- Engine type: Six-cylinder turbodiesel (V6).
- Displacement: 2.958 dm3.
- EEC rating: 130 kW (176 bhp) at 4000 r/min.
- EEC peak torque: 350 Nm at 1800—3000 r/min.
- Transmission: Manual 5-speed.
- Top speed: 215 km/h (Wagon 210 km/h).
- Acceleration to 100 km/h: 9.3 sec (Wagon 9.8 sec).
- Overtaking acceleration: 60—100 km/h in fourth gear 7.5 sec (Wagon 7.7 sec).
- Fuel consumption 1/100 km*: 10.0/5.8/7.3 (Wagon 10.3/6.0/7.6).
- C02 emission g/km*: 259/150/191 (Wagon 272/161/202).
* City/Highway/Combined according to 1999/100 EC. Figures for the 9-5 2.2 TID automatic not available at the time of final editing.
